The Shocking Truth: Russian Army Abandons and Attacks its Own Soldiers, says Captured Occupier

The Russian army turned out to be not at all the second army in the world; moreover, it demonstrated another shameful sign, as described by the captured occupier.

A Russian prisoner of war from the Storm Z detachment admitted that when the Ukrainian Armed Forces took him prisoner, the Russian army began shooting at him and his brothers. “Two of us were taken prisoner. There were four in total. Two died. When they heard from the shooting that the Ukrainian Armed Forces wanted to take us prisoner, they started working on us. It flew within a radius of 10-15 meters,”told occupier in an interview with Vladimir Zolkin, which can be viewed on the YouTube channel Volodymyr Zolkin.

According to the prisoner, the Russian army worked on its own soldiers from a drone so that they would not be captured by the Ukrainian Armed Forces.

“Did you have a different opinion about your army?” – asked the journalist.

“Yes, – the occupier replied. – Everyone says (in Russia – ed.) that we have the second army in the world, normal weapons and training, and treat everything very strictly. In the end, there is none of this. And they say that they don’t abandon their own people. But, as I told you, they abandoned us and started working on us.”

“Is this exactly what they threw? Usually they just don’t throw it, they leave it, but they threw it and wanted to finish it off,” – Zolkin clarified.

“Yes, you can say that” – the prisoner agreed.

Then the occupier suggested that the Russian army wanted to kill its own soldiers so that they would not reveal any important information in captivity, although, in fact, none of them had any information.
